Property Description for 465 Park Ave, 34-E

This glamorous two bedroom, two bath apartment is the epitome of White Glove living. Have the best of everything in the world-renowned Ritz Tower located at the crossroads of the world on Billionaire's Row!

The hotel-style amenities include maid service and concierge, lunch and dinner served in your apartment or the private dining room. There is a new state-of-the-art fitness center, and conference room.

Off a semi-private landing, this high floor tower apartment has an ideal layout and beautifully proportioned rooms, with high ceilings, outstanding views and brilliant light all day long.

The large living room has four east-facing windows, herringbone floors, space for multiple seating areas and a lovely dining area.

French doors lead into the the primary bedroom, which has a decorative fireplace, built-in bookcase and walk-in closet. The en suite Carrara Italian marble bathroom has two windows, a jacuzzi and a beautiful Sherle Wagner sink with gold-plated fixtures. There is also a marble dressing table and a closet.

The stunning library is lined in French oak paneling and has a decorative fireplace and built-in bookcase. With two closets, including a large walk-in, it can serve as a second bathroom. There is a windowed en suite Carrara Italian marble bathroom with a stall shower, Sherle Wagner sink with gold-plated fixtures, and a closet.

The fully renovated kitchen has top-of-the-line appliances, including a Sub-Zero refrigerator, Miele dishwasher, Gaggenau stove, and GE convection/microwave oven. It has a Kohler sink with filtered water, marble countertops and floor, under-the-counter and recessed lighting.

Facing North, South and East, there are breathtaking views, from the George Washington Bridge and Central Park to the Empire State Building. At night, the views of the city lights are magical!

The apartment has been renovated in the French style and is in move-in condition; it has through-the-wall HVAC in every room.

The maintenance includes utilities and real estate taxes. Pieds-a-terre and foreign purchasers are permitted, as are purchases in the name of a trust, LLCs and corporate ownership, subject to board approval. 50% financing is allowed, and there is a 3% purchaser flip tax. Small pets are permitted with board approval.

Designed by famed architect Emery Roth, the Ritz Tower is a 41-story coop building that was built in 1926. The lobby and common areas were recently renovated. Quick Profile

Midtown West and Midtown East have a lot in common. They’re bustling, iconic, and full of people. But just like siblings, their personalities can be vastly different. Midtown East is a bit more sophisticated and doesn’t quite have the vivacity and unruliness that its westerly counterpart exudes. 

Midtown East is bordered by 42nd to the south, 59th Street to the north, 5th Avenue to the west, and 3rd Avenue to the east. 

The neighborhood is famous for its high-end stores, tourist attractions, posh hotels (budget ones too), and iconic architecture. Midtown East is also one of the largest financial and business hubs in Manhattan. During normal business hours the sidewalks are full of commuters and people moving from point A to point B. In the early evening, when the masses have left for the day, things suddenly get a little quieter and the sidewalks have a lot less foot traffic.  

Although largely a commercial neighborhood, residential areas of Midtown East do exist on the eastern section of the neighborhood. 

Grand Central Station is located in Midtown East and like Midtown West, it’s an extremely commutable neighborhood. The 4, 5, 6, 7 and S trains whisk people in and out of the neighborhood 24 hours a day. Grand Central Station also serves as a hub for New York State and Connecticut commuter rails. These trains can take you anywhere along the Hudson River or up into Connecticut. It’s perfect for day tripping.
